Two teenagers drown

DERA MURAD JAMALI: Two youngsters drowned in Pat Feeder canal in Sobatpur district on Monday.

Police said two teenagers, Naveed Ahmed and Owais Ahmed, were bathing in the canal when they waded into deeper water and drowned.

Rescue workers along with police personnel rushed to the site but could not trace the bodies till late evening. The bodies were likely to be washed ashore due to high stream pressure from the Indus river, said the rescue workers.
